19 of the greatest quotes on Zinedine Zidane: ‘Born with a ball at his feet’

It is usually great goalscorers that are mentioned in debates around the greatest player of all time, but make no mistake about it, Zinedine Zidane deserves to be in that conversation.

The France icon did score goals – and great ones at that – but he captured the imagination due to his all-round game. Zizou matched grace with power, subtlety with skills and humility with the odd reminder that he was the boss.

But rather than pay tribute to the former Bordeaux, Juventus and Real Madrid ourselves, we’ve left it to the experts – the players and managers who got to witness his greatness firsthand.

Franco Baresi

“He was as elegant as a dancer – he even used the soles of his boots efficiently. Everything was easy for him; he made such movements that if I tried to copy them I would break my legs.”

Gary Lineker

“The most elegant footballer I have ever seen.”

Fabien Barthez

“For me, he’s the greatest player of the century. The best player of all time.”

Zlatan Ibrahimovic

“When Zidane stepped onto the pitch, the 10 other guys just got suddenly better. It is that simple. It was magic.

“He was a unique player. He was more than good, he came from another planet. His team-mates became like him when he was on the pitch.”

Marcel Desailly

“A true artist. What he could do with the ball was incredible. Only Maradona could do the same. Zizou was also a player capable of rising to the occasion at important moments, and deciding games.”

Paul Scholes

“To see Zidane in action was to witness poetry in motion. The skills, the vision, the goals…he was a sublime performer. When he was at his peak, winning the World Cup, the Champions League and all the rest, he was unquestionably the finest player on the planet.”

Ronaldinho

“Zidane is one of the best footballers of all time, one of my idols. He had such elegance and grace, a wonderful touch and superb vision.”

Emmanuel Petit

“I think he was born with a ball at his feet. I think when the doctor pulled him out, he said ‘This is weird, there is a ball here!'”

Edwin van der Sar

“A very normal guy. I remember guys coming in with their Ferraris, Porsches and Lamborghinis, and Zizou comes in with a Fiat Punto. The aura he had, the way he moved on the pitch was special.”

Alfredo Di Stefano

“He dominates the ball, he is a walking spectacle and he plays as if he had silk gloves on each foot. He makes it worthwhile going to the stadium – he’s one of the best I have ever seen.”

David Beckham

“To train with Zidane for three years was a dream. For me, he is the greatest player of all time.”

Thierry Henry

“In France, everybody realised that God exists and that he is back in the French international team. God is back, there is little left to say.”

Ivan Campo

“Zizou is a god!”

Franz Beckenbauer

“Zidane is unique. The ball flows with him. He is more like a dancer than a football player.”

Pelé

“Zidane is the master. Over the past 10 years there’s been no-one like him, he has been the best player in the world.”

Marcello Lippi

“The greatest player of the past 20 years? It has to be Zidane. He had everything. You never needed to tell him anything as he did it all by himself and knew what was expected.”

Jean-Louis Murat

“Nobody knows if Zidane is an angel or demon. He smiles like Saint Teresa and grimaces like a serial killer.”

Cesare Maldini

“I would give up five players to have Zidane in my squad.”

Luka Modric

“Every piece of advice he gives you is like gold dust and it helps you improve on the pitch.”
